2.1 Sierra Leone Port of Freetown | Digital Logistics Capacity

Freetown Port has one of the finest natural harbours on the West African Coast, with a well-protected anchorage, a draft at berth of 7-10 meters, a length of quay of 1,067 meters consisting of 6 berths, and sizable and fenced land area allocated for the port. Freetown (SLFNA)

Freetown is a seaport near Freetown in Sierra Leone (SL). It is 13km away from the nearest airport (Lungi International Airport). The offical LOCODE for this seaport is SLFNA. How many containers can be delivered from the port of Freetown?

All containers should be scanned through the scanning machine available at the Customs in the port. The capacity of scanning is between 100 – 120 containers per day. What is a multi-energy system in a seaport?

As illustrated in Fig. 2, in the energy supply side of seaport, we consider a multi-energy system that combining onsite photovoltaic (PV), wind turbine (WT), bulk power grid, and CCHP systems, which consumes fuel and electricity, and provides power, heating, and cooling service for vessels.
